Victim suffers serious injuries following a Prince George shooting

Prince George Mounties are investigating a rural shooting incident.

It occurred this morning (Friday) just before 1:00 at a residence on the 3200 block of Torpy Road.

“Police officers, including the Emergency Response Team, are currently at that location as we continue to collect evidence in this investigation. Our initial findings indicate this was likely a targeted event and there is no increased risk to the general public. If anyone in the neighbourhood witnessed the event or saw something suspicious we ask that they please contact the Prince George RCMP to speak with police,” said Cpl. Jennifer Cooper, Media Relations Officer for the Prince George RCMP.

According to police, a victim was transported to the hospital for treatment of his serious but non-life-threatening injuries.

Investigators will be out on Torpy Road for the bulk of the day as the investigation is ongoing.
